HF Phase-1 Upgrades QIE RM-uHTR protocol proposal Marcelo Vicente (University of Wisconsin-Madison) 1.

Slides:



Advertisements
Similar presentations
Status of the CTP O.Villalobos Baillie University of Birmingham April 23rd 2009.
Advertisements

DIGITAL COMMUNICATION Packet error detection (CRC) November 2011 A.J. Han Vinck.
HIGH-LEVEL DATA LINK CONTROL (HDLC) HDLC was defined by ISO for use on both point-to-point and multipoint data links. It supports full-duplex communication.
1 SpaceWire Update NASA GSFC November 25, GSFC SpaceWire Status New Link core with split clock domains complete (Much faster) New Router core.
8-Reliability and Channel Coding Dr. John P. Abraham Professor UTPA.
EEC-484/584 Computer Networks
CMPE 150- Introduction to Computer Networks 1 CMPE 150 Fall 2005 Lecture 12 Introduction to Computer Networks.
DAQ WS02 Feb 2006Jean-Sébastien GraulichSlide 1 Does IPM System Matches MICE needs ? Personal Understanding and Remarks o General Considerations o Front.
Microprocessors Introduction to ia64 Architecture Jan 31st, 2002 General Principles.
Chapter 2 : Direct Link Networks (Continued). So far... Modulation and Encoding Link layer protocols Error Detection -- Parity Check.
Ionization Profile Monitor Project Current Status of IPM Buffer Board Project 10 February 2006 Rick Kwarciany.
1 Internet Networking Spring 2002 Tutorial 2 IP Checksum, Fragmentation.
CS335 Networking & Network Administration Tuesday, April 13, 2010.
CS 640: Introduction to Computer Networks Aditya Akella Lecture 5 - Encoding and Data Link Basics.
UPDATE BTL Testing. Current Status What Test Package to Use? Upgrading to New Protocol Revisions Key Test Package Differences Developer Notes for Protocol.
PicoTDC Features of the picoTDC (operating at 1280 MHz with 64 delay cells) Focus of the unit on very small time bins, 12ps basic, 3ps interpolation Interpolation.
Security Issues in PIM-SM Link-local Messages J.W. Atwood, Salekul Islam {bill, Department.
Bjorn Landfeldt, The University of Sydney 1 NETS 3303 Networked Systems Revision.
September 8-14, th Workshop on Electronics for LHC1 Channel Control ASIC for the CMS Hadron Calorimeter Front End Readout Module Ray Yarema, Alan.
Network Applications and Layered Architectures Protocols OSI Reference Model.
23 February 2004 Christos Zamantzas 1 LHC Beam Loss Monitor Design Considerations: Digital Parts at the Tunnel Internal Review.
Tracking Locations of Moving Hand-Held Displays Using Projected Light Jay Summet and Rahul Sukthankar Georgia Institute of Technology,Intel Research Pittsburgh.
Measurement opportunities with the LHC transverse damper W. Hofle, D. Valuch.
DSR: Introduction Reference: D. B. Johnson, D. A. Maltz, Y.-C. Hu, and J. G. Jetcheva, “The Dynamic Source Routing Protocol for Mobile Ad Hoc Networks,”
1 CS4550: Computer Networks II Review Data Link Layer.
1 Dong Wang, Yaping Wang, Changzhou Xiang, Zhongbao Yin, Fan Zhang, Daicui Zhou (Huazhong Normal University, China) Status and planning on common readout.
CMS ECAL DAQ Fiber data block format Magnus Hansen
Error/Flow Control Modeling (ARQ Modeling). © Tallal Elshabrawy 2 Data Link Layer  Data Link Layer provides a service for Network Layer (transfer of.
UNIVERSITY OF JYVÄSKYLÄ 2005 Multicast Admission Control in DiffServ Networks Department of Mathematical Information Technology University of Jyväskylä.
FPGA firmware of DC5 FEE. Outline List of issue Data loss issue Command error issue (DCM to FEM) Command lost issue (PC with USB connection to GANDALF)
COMADC Board and Etc. Jinyuan Wu For CKM Collaboration.
Tdoc #: GAHW Agenda: GPP TSG GERAN Adhoc #2 October 9-13, 2000, Munich Germany GERAN Voice and Data Multiplexing (OS2) Proposal Source:AT&T,
HB LED Pulser Boards By Michael Miller The University of Iowa.
Lecture 4 Mechanisms & Kernel for NOSs. Mechanisms for Network Operating Systems  Network operating systems provide three basic mechanisms that support.
A Super-TFC for a Super-LHCb (II) 1. S-TFC on xTCA – Mapping TFC on Marseille hardware 2. ECS+TFC relay in FE Interface 3. Protocol and commands for FE/BE.
CMS Upgrade Workshop – Nov 20, H C A L Upgrade Workshop CMS HCAL Working Group FE Electronics: New GOL Nov 20, 2007 HCAL personnel interested in.
Integration and commissioning of the Pile-Up VETO.
BCT’s for beam protection L. Søby On behalf of D. Belohrad, L. Jensen and P. Odier 6/12/15Internal workshop ON MPP readiness for MJ beams 1.
Trigger Workshop: Greg Iles Feb Optical Global Trigger Interface Card Dual CMC card with Virtex 5 LX110T 16 bidirectional.
Plans and Progress on the FPGA+ADC Card Pack Chris Tully Princeton University Upgrade Workshop, Fermilab October 28, 2009.
QIE10 development Nov. 7, 2011: The first full-chip prototype was submitted to MOSIS. Output is 2-bit exponent (four ranges) and 6-bit mantissa (non-linear.
Some Details on CKM Data Format Jinyuan Wu for CKM Collaboration April 2002.
LHC CMS Detector Upgrade Project RCT/CTP7 Readout Isobel Ojalvo, U. Wisconsin Level-1 Trigger Meeting June 4, June 2015, Isobel Ojalvo Trigger Meeting:
How to get a CADian authority code ? (First registration) 301, Suite 448, Gasan-dong, Gumcheon-gu, Seoul, Korea Helpdesk :
Within ATLAS both TILECal and LAr are planning upgrades to the readout systems - current systems will reach limits on radiation exposure aging of components.
Trigger Gigabit Serial Data Transfer Walter Miller Professor David Doughty CNU October 4, 2007.
10/3/2003Andreas Jansson - Tevatron IPM review1 Tevatron IPM Proposed design.
Data Communications Data Link Layer.
GEM Firmware Concerns & Development Plans GEM Firmware Workshop February 2016 Texas A&M University 1.
HCAL upgrade FPGA FW: tasks and issues 12 May2016 Tullio Grassi, Univ. of Maryland.
E. Hazen1 HCAL DAQ To Do List Here come the protons! But still lots to do... DQM Tweaks HO Trigger Links New DCC Selective readout.
Straw readout status Run 2016 Cover FW SRB FW.
Alberto Valero 17 de Diciembre de 2007
The Moving Pixel Company
Internet Networking Spring 2002
CRU Weekly Meeting Discussion on Trigger
Data Link Layer What does it do?
Dell Customer Support Service Dell Customer Support Service REACH AT Dell Support : Give a Ring on:
Lec 5 Layers Computer Networks Al-Mustansiryah University
Lecture 2 Overview.
HCAL Configuration Issues
May 2018 Project: IEEE P Working Group for Wireless Personal Area Networks (WPANs) Submission Title: [Discussion on Suitable Parameters for SCHC]
Rivier College CS575: Advanced LANs Chapter 6: Logical Link Control
Lecture 7 review Consider a link running the Go-Back-N protocol. Suppose the transmission delay and propagation delay are both 1ms, the window size is.
May 2018 Project: IEEE P Working Group for Wireless Personal Area Networks (WPANs) Submission Title: [Discussion on Suitable Parameters for SCHC]
Chapter 8 Software Evolution.
Building A Network: Cost Effective Resource Sharing
Global chip connections
Reliability and Error Control 5/17/11
Data Communication and Computer Networks
Presentation transcript:

HF Phase-1 Upgrades QIE RM-uHTR protocol proposal Marcelo Vicente (University of Wisconsin-Madison) 1

Current Protocol Two main issues: Lack of error checking and realignment mechanisms. Goal: Improve long term reliability and mitigate possible instabilities. Byte\Bit K28.5 (0xBC) 1TDCE3TDCE2TDCE1TDC0Link IDBC0 2CapId 3CapId 2CapId 1CapId 0 3QIE ADC 0 4QIE ADC 1 5QIE ADC 2 6QIE ADC 3 7LE TDC 3 [5:4]LE TDC 2 [5:4]LE TDC 1 [5:4]LE TDC 0 [5:4] 8LE TDC 3 [3:2]LE TDC 2 [3:2]LE TDC 1 [3:2]LE TDC 0 [3:2] 9LE TDC 3 [1:0]LE TDC 2 [1:0]LE TDC 1 [1:0]LE TDC 0 [1:0] 10TE TDC 1TE TDC 0 11TE TDC 3TE TDC 2 2

Packet improvements BC0 included in the header as a different K-character. CRC-4-ITU included as the last 4 bits of each packet. Link ID moved to a test mode, only required for commissioning. Byte\Bit K28.5 (0xBC) 1TDCE3TDCE2TDCE1TDC0Link IDBC0 2CapId 3CapId 2CapId 1CapId 0 3QIE ADC 0 4QIE ADC 1 5QIE ADC 2 6QIE ADC 3 7LE TDC 3 [5:4]LE TDC 2 [5:4]LE TDC 1 [5:4]LE TDC 0 [5:4] 8LE TDC 3 [3:2]LE TDC 2 [3:2]LE TDC 1 [3:2]LE TDC 0 [3:2] 9LE TDC 3 [1:0]LE TDC 2 [1:0]LE TDC 1 [1:0]LE TDC 0 [1:0] 10TE TDC 1TE TDC 0 11TE TDC 3TE TDC 2 Byte\Bit K28.5 (0xBC) / K28.3 (0x7C) when BC0 1TE TDC 1TE TDC 0 2CapId 3CapId 2CapId 1CapId 0 3QIE ADC 0 4QIE ADC 1 5QIE ADC 2 6QIE ADC 3 7LE TDC 3 [5:4]LE TDC 2 [5:4]LE TDC 1 [5:4]LE TDC 0 [5:4] 8LE TDC 3 [3:2]LE TDC 2 [3:2]LE TDC 1 [3:2]LE TDC 0 [3:2] 9LE TDC 3 [1:0]LE TDC 2 [1:0]LE TDC 1 [1:0]LE TDC 0 [1:0] 10TE TDC 3TE TDC 2 11CRC-4-ITUTDCE3TDCE2TDCE1TDC0 3 Current protocol:Revised protocol:

Realignment Add an IDLE period during TCDS veto gap (BXs ) on every orbit. Have 4 pre-sample of digis before BC0 and 4 IDLE packets before that. Avoids writing complicated realignment code on the uHTR. Realignment is done automatically every orbit, similar to the legacy system. 4

Underlying question Is the data during the ‘dark’ gap period (BXs ) relevant? All triggers will be vetoed by TCDS during those crossings. 5

Test mode 1 Propagation of unique ID and BCN counter. Already present, with the exception of the CRC. 6 Byte\Bit K28.5 (0xBC) / K28.3 (0x7C) when BC0 1Minor Version 2Unique ID [7:0] 3Unique ID [15:8] 4Unique ID [23:16] 5Unique ID [31:24] 6Unique ID [39:32] 7Unique ID [47:40] 8Unique ID [55:48] 9Unique ID [63:56] 10Bunch crossing number counter [7:0] 11CRC-4-ITUT/BFiber NumberBC0

Test mode 2 80-bits of programmable words, allowing propagation of fiber ID codes. Easier commission of fibre installation at P5. 7 Byte\Bit K28.5 (0xBC) / K28.3 (0x7C) when BC0 1Custom word 0 [7:0] 2Custom word 0 [15:8] 3Custom word 1 [7:0] 4Custom word 1 [15:8] 5Custom word 2 [7:0] 6Custom word 2 [15:8] 7Custom word 3 [7:0] 8Custom word 3 [15:8] 9Custom word 4 [7:0] 10Custom word 4 [15:8] 11CRC-4-ITUT/BFiber NumberBC0